Business Support Partner

Cheadle  

The Business Support Partners (BSP) will provide highly proactive business support and are able to continually demonstrate effective partnering with members of the Leadership Team first line and peers across Thales UK.

You will need extensive knowledge of the organisation or can demonstrate an ability to grasp the business values and behaviours quickly. Networking with key personnel (internal and external) and understand their Director’s and organisation’s aims and objectives.

The BSPs will be expected to work autonomously or as part of a team, making sound calculated decisions on behalf of their Directors.  In addition to business acumen, it is expected BSPs act with discretion and confidentially at all times.

Key tasks and responsibilities

The BSP will act as their Directors first point of contact with internal and external stakeholders.

 Key tasks include:

  • Full autonomy of the Director’s diary to maximise the time focusing on the business priorities and to eliminate the waste.

  • Co-ordination of the organisation and preparation of meetings across multiple time zones, ensuring all materials are provided. In some cases taking ownership of the meeting; producing agendas, reports, attending and participating in meetings and taking minutes or actions.

  • Managing complex travel itineraries and visas where necessary, ensuring that best route and value is obtained and monitoring budgets where required.  Ensuring that all documentation and the relevant security processes are completed prior to travel

  • High level email management for self and Director. 

  • Influence, negotiate and manage conflicting demands in every aspect of the role

  • Examples of Business support required across functions and programmes

  • Marketing and events – organise, support and co-ordinate all aspects of internal and external events. Proficient in use of GCRM events management system for customer attendees.

  • Communications – writing and proof-reading communications on behalf of the Director, co-ordinating site communications plans and work closely with internal and external communications managers.  Create and publish documents on the intranet, such as organisation charts

  • Supporting UK Lead and site initiatives – E.g. Deputy Travel Manager role, actively participating at Thales UK meetings and report updates and usage directly to Operations Director.  Managing two-way communication with the Business Support Team and wider Community, to ensure that travel processes, procedures and costs are delivered successfully.

  • Undertake and/or lead ad hoc projects as directed by the BSM or Leadership team

  • Provide research where required, compiling reports, data and presentations to summarise findings

  • Be competent in undertaking ad hoc requisitions and other system procedures identified, including digital collaboration tools.

  • Create, manage and champion policies and processes eg Smart Working.  An ambassador for change, able to educate stakeholders as necessary.

  • Provide cover for other Business Support Partners during absence

  • Any other ad hoc tasks as directed by stakeholders and the BSM

Skills and experience

  • Demonstrates high level of business awareness, excellent communication skills (verbal and written) and ability to interact effectively, courteously and professionally both within internal and external customer communities

  • Able to prioritise workload and complete work within agreed timescales to outstanding quality requiring minimal rework/no rework.

  • Must be able to work independently as the Director will often be out of the office. Self-motivated and enthusiastic.

  • A strong personality and credibility to act on behalf of the Directors / managers authority as required

  • Have outstanding organisation skills. Ability to meet stretch deadlines and demands of the team. To be proactive in finding solutions to problems.

  • Ability to ‘think on feet’ and make last minute decisions working within pressurised situations

  • People management and leadership skills

  • Ability to build relationships within the Business Support Community and actively promotes the value and positive perception of the team.

  • Able to deal with people at all levels of the organisation but predominately experience in dealing with senior business leaders and Directors.

  • Experience in virtual and digital technology

  • Handles confidential and sensitive information in a discrete and controlled manner.

  • Advanced skills in MS office software (Outlook, Word, Excel, Visio & PowerPoint)

  • Excellent spoken and written English.

  • Effective personal organisation and an ability to remain composed and focused under pressure

Minimum 3 years’ experience as a PA to a Director or equivalent in a busy business environment.  Knowledge and experience of supporting other business functions and understanding of how they integrate with each other.

This role will require SC Clearance. It would be advantageous if currently held, however, if not currently held, it is a requirement that the successful applicant will undergo, achieve, and maintain SC Clearance.  Please visit the UKSV website for further guidance.

To be eligible for full SC, you generally need to have resided in the UK for the last 5 years.  In some circumstances, a minimum of 3 years’ residence in the UK over the last 5 years may be accepted, with additional overseas checks.
